What Is Wernicke-Korsakoff Syndrome (“Wet Brain”)?

Wernicke-Korsakoff syndrome (WKS), commonly referred to as “wet brain,” is a serious neurological disorder most often linked to heavy, prolonged alcohol use. It arises primarily from a thiamine (vitamin B1) deficiency. Thiamine is crucial for many metabolic processes in the body, including those that help the brain produce energy. When someone lacks sufficient thiamine, areas of the brain — particularly those involved in memory, coordination and decision-making — can sustain damage.

WKS is considered a two-stage disorder. The first stage is known as Wernicke’s encephalopathy, a short-term but severe condition, and the second stage is known as Korsakoff psychosis (or Korsakoff syndrome), a chronic and potentially irreversible condition. People often develop Wernicke’s encephalopathy symptoms first. If Wernicke’s goes untreated, it may transition into Korsakoff psychosis, characterized by severe memory problems and disorientation. Recognizing symptoms of Wernicke’s encephalopathy early and seeking prompt medical intervention can help prevent further progression into Korsakoff psychosis.

Although Wernicke-Korsakoff syndrome is heavily associated with chronic alcoholism, it can also occur in people who have severely poor nutritional intake or absorption problems for other reasons. However, alcohol misuse remains the leading cause of this disorder in the United States.

The Link Between Alcohol Misuse and Wernicke-Korsakoff Syndrome

Alcohol misuse has a strong connection to the development of Wernicke-Korsakoff syndrome for several reasons:

  • Poor Nutrition: Many people who struggle with chronic alcohol misuse do not eat a nutritionally balanced diet. They often consume calories primarily from alcohol, neglecting essential nutrients — including thiamine.
  • Impaired Absorption: Long-term alcohol use can disrupt the body’s ability to absorb and use thiamine. Even if a person consuming excessive alcohol attempts a healthier diet, the damage to their digestive system and liver may still impair nutrient absorption.
  • Increased Thiamine Requirement: Heavy drinking can speed up the metabolism of thiamine, causing the body to use it faster. This increased need, paired with decreased intake, leads to a quicker depletion of vitamin B1.
  • Liver Damage: Chronic alcohol misuse can damage the liver, an organ vital for metabolizing nutrients and detoxifying the body. When the liver is compromised, thiamine stores are depleted more rapidly, further increasing the risk of deficiency.

Due to these factors, individuals with a history of heavy, prolonged drinking are at a higher risk of developing Wernicke-Korsakoff syndrome. Addressing alcohol misuse is vital not only for overall health but also to prevent the neurological damage associated with thiamine deficiency.

Risk Factors for Developing Wet Brain

While the disorder is most closely associated with chronic alcoholism, several groups of people can be at risk for Wernicke-Korsakoff syndrome, including:

  • People with Chronic Alcohol Misuse: Heavy drinkers have the highest risk, given the nutritional deficits and absorption problems caused by alcohol.
  • Individuals with Eating Disorders: Eating disorders such as anorexia nervosa or bulimia nervosa can lead to severe nutritional deficiencies, including low thiamine levels.
  • Those with Malabsorption Issues: Conditions like Crohn’s disease or celiac disease can prevent the body from effectively absorbing thiamine and other nutrients.
  • Post-Bariatric Surgery Patients: Some types of bariatric surgery alter the digestive system in ways that reduce nutrient absorption, including vitamins and minerals like B1.
  • People Undergoing Prolonged IV Feeding: Total parenteral nutrition (TPN) that lacks adequate vitamin supplementation can lead to a thiamine deficiency.
  • Individuals Experiencing Extreme Starvation or Famine: Severe lack of food over an extended period can deplete thiamine and other essential nutrients.

Still, chronic alcohol misuse remains the dominant cause of Wernicke-Korsakoff syndrome in the United States. Anyone who drinks alcohol heavily or struggles with other conditions that impact their nutritional status should be aware of the warning signs associated with thiamine deficiency.

Wernicke-Korsakoff Syndrome (Wet Brain) Symptoms

Wernicke-Korsakoff syndrome is typically broken down into two phases — Wernicke’s encephalopathy and Korsakoff psychosis. Although these stages have distinct symptoms, they may overlap in time or develop in quick succession.

Wernicke’s Encephalopathy Symptoms

Wernicke’s encephalopathy is the acute and urgent phase of WKS. Common symptoms can include:

  • Confusion and Disorientation: The person may appear dazed or incapable of processing information properly. This confusion can be intermittent or constant.
  • Ataxia (Poor Coordination): Problems with balance and gait are common, leading individuals to walk unsteadily or have difficulty performing tasks that require fine motor coordination.
  • Eye Movement Abnormalities: One of the hallmark signs is ophthalmoplegia, or paralysis of the eye muscles, which can result in double vision or irregular eye movements.
  • Nystagmus: Rapid, involuntary eye movements back and forth can also occur.
  • Changes in Mental Status: A general decrease in alertness or responsiveness can occur, and in some cases, people may become apathetic or have trouble concentrating.

Wernicke’s encephalopathy is considered a medical emergency. If it is not treated immediately with high-dose thiamine, it can progress to Korsakoff psychosis or result in permanent brain damage. In severe cases, it may even be fatal.

Korsakoff Psychosis Symptoms

If Wernicke’s encephalopathy goes unrecognized or untreated, the brain damage can evolve into Korsakoff psychosis (also known simply as Korsakoff syndrome), a more chronic, long-term condition. Korsakoff psychosis symptoms include:

  • Severe Memory Impairment: Specifically, individuals often struggle with forming new memories (anterograde amnesia). They might also have difficulty recalling recent memories (retrograde amnesia).
  • Confabulation: A characteristic sign of Korsakoff syndrome is the tendency to make up stories without the conscious intent to deceive. These invented memories often fill in gaps to maintain a coherent narrative of events.
  • Personality Changes: Apathy, irritability or mood swings may be noticeable.
  • Reduced Insight: People with Korsakoff psychosis may be unaware of the extent of their memory problems and confusion.
  • Disorientation: Even familiar environments can seem unfamiliar, and individuals might lose track of time, dates or important events.

Korsakoff psychosis can cause long-lasting or permanent damage, making early intervention with Wernicke’s encephalopathy crucial. However, with consistent treatment and abstinence from alcohol, some recovery of memory and cognitive function is possible, although it may be incomplete.

Diagnosing Wernicke-Korsakoff Syndrome

Diagnosing Wernicke-Korsakoff syndrome can be challenging due to its resemblance to other neurological and psychiatric disorders. A thorough evaluation will typically include:

  • Medical History and Examination: A doctor will ask about alcohol use patterns, nutritional intake and any medical conditions that may affect vitamin absorption. They will also evaluate a patient’s reflexes, coordination and ocular movements.
  • Neurological Assessment: Neurologists or other specialists might perform standardized tests to gauge memory, cognition and motor function.
  • Blood Tests: While there is no single test that definitively confirms Wernicke-Korsakoff syndrome, blood tests can check levels of thiamine, liver function and other markers that can indicate poor nutrition or alcohol-related damage.
  • Imaging Scans: MRI (magnetic resonance imaging) or CT (computed tomography) scans can help identify areas of the brain that show damage typical of WKS, such as lesions in the thalamus or hypothalamus.
  • Neuropsychological Testing: Particularly for suspected Korsakoff psychosis, a neuropsychological exam may help identify the extent of memory impairment, confabulation and other cognitive deficits.

Early recognition and diagnosis of Wernicke’s encephalopathy is essential. If someone with a high suspicion of the disorder presents with confusion, ataxia and eye abnormalities, doctors often begin thiamine supplementation immediately, rather than waiting for test results. Delay in treatment can cause irreversible damage.

Is Wernicke-Korsakoff Syndrome Preventable?

In many cases, Wernicke-Korsakoff syndrome is preventable. A well-balanced diet that includes adequate thiamine is the most straightforward preventive measure. Foods rich in vitamin B1 include whole grains, legumes, nuts, seeds, lean meats (especially pork) and fortified cereals. When dietary intake is insufficient, a daily multivitamin or thiamine supplement can help bridge any nutritional gaps.

For individuals who struggle with chronic alcohol misuse, prevention also hinges on reducing or eliminating alcohol use. By cutting down on alcohol and improving overall nutrition, a person can help ensure better absorption and retention of vitamins and minerals. Additionally, seeking professional help for alcohol use disorder can address the root problem of excessive drinking, preventing many of the complications that arise from chronic alcohol misuse.

Healthcare professionals treating people with a history of alcoholism or conditions that lead to nutritional deficiencies often recommend routine thiamine supplementation. In hospitals, thiamine is frequently given intravenously to malnourished patients or those at risk for Wernicke-Korsakoff syndrome to rapidly restore levels and reduce the risk of permanent brain damage.

Can Wernicke-Korsakoff Syndrome Be Reversed?

The reversibility of Wernicke-Korsakoff syndrome depends largely on the stage at which it is caught and treated.

  • Wernicke’s Encephalopathy: This acute phase can often be reversed, at least partially, if high doses of thiamine are administered quickly. Some symptoms, such as confusion and eye movement problems, may improve rapidly when vitamin B1 levels are restored.
  • Korsakoff Psychosis: Korsakoff psychosis is harder to reverse fully. While some patients experience improvements in memory and cognition with abstinence from alcohol, consistent use of thiamine supplements and proper nutrition, others may have lingering or permanent memory deficits.

Early recognition and intervention are key. The quicker someone with Wernicke’s encephalopathy receives treatment, the lower the chance of irreversible brain damage and the less likely that person is to progress to Korsakoff psychosis. Regardless of the stage, abstaining from alcohol is vital to preventing further brain damage and maximizing any potential recovery.

Wernicke-Korsakoff Syndrome Treatment

Treatment for Wernicke-Korsakoff syndrome focuses on correcting the thiamine deficiency and addressing underlying causes:

  • High-Dose Thiamine Replacement: This is usually delivered intravenously (IV) initially to ensure rapid absorption. Oral thiamine supplements may be used once the condition has stabilized or in milder cases.
  • Nutritional Support: Patients often need a more comprehensive nutritional plan that addresses other deficiencies, such as magnesium or folate. A balanced diet and possibly additional supplementation help improve overall health and facilitate recovery.
  • Alcohol Abstinence: Continued alcohol use can undermine treatment and lead to further brain damage. Cessation of alcohol is crucial for recovery, slowing disease progression and allowing the brain to heal.
  • Supportive Care: Depending on the severity, patients may require physical therapy to regain coordination and occupational therapy to adapt to any long-term cognitive or motor deficits.
  • Psychological and Psychiatric Support: Therapy and counseling can help individuals cope with memory loss, confusion or personality changes. In some cases, medications might be prescribed to help manage mood symptoms or other co-occurring mental health issues.

Because WKS can impair judgment and decision-making, it may also be necessary for families and medical professionals to assist in ensuring that the individual follows through with treatment, takes supplements and maintains sobriety.

Treatment for Alcohol Use Disorder

Addressing the root cause of Wernicke-Korsakoff syndrome — most commonly chronic alcohol misuse — is essential. If alcohol use continues unchecked, even the best medical interventions may not prevent ongoing brain damage. Fortunately, there are effective treatments for alcohol use disorder (AUD):

  • Medical Detox: For people who have been drinking heavily for a long time, a medically supervised detox is often the safest way to manage withdrawal symptoms. Doctors and nurses monitor vital signs and may administer medications to mitigate the risks of severe withdrawal complications.
  • Inpatient or Residential Rehab: During inpatient treatment, individuals live on-site at a rehab facility and receive around-the-clock care. This structured environment can help break the cycle of alcohol misuse, while offering therapy, support groups and activities to begin long-term recovery.
  • Outpatient Programs: Outpatient treatment provides more flexibility for individuals who cannot commit to a full-time, residential program. They attend counseling and therapy sessions at scheduled times while still living at home.
  • Medication-Assisted Treatment (MAT): Certain medications, such as naltrexone, acamprosate or disulfiram, can help reduce cravings and prevent relapse. These medications are typically used alongside therapy for a comprehensive approach.
  • Behavioral Therapies: Cognitive behavioral therapy (CBT), motivational interviewing (MI) and contingency management (CM) are evidence-based methods that help individuals identify triggers, develop healthy coping strategies and stay motivated.
  • Support Groups: Groups like Alcoholics Anonymous (AA) or SMART Recovery provide peer support, accountability and a framework for maintaining sobriety.
